Musical literature has a long history that can be traced back to the trinity period of ancientpoetry, music and dance. In Pre-qin and Han dynasty, poems didn’t separate with music, whichmeans original music still belongs to literature. Poetry works mostly are musicalliteratures.Musical literature is the initial stage of literature.Based on the analysis of music and literature works in pre-Qin periods, the combination ofrelevant data in excavated documents and the related literature handed down from ancient times,standing on the perspective point of musical literature, the article studies the representativework of pre-Qin musical literature, reviews the works of pre-Qin literature, and tries to discoverthe characteristics of musical literature so as to explore the hierarchy, education system, fieldand musical suspense system of the pre-Qin musical literature, revive ‘ecological’ status of thepre-Qin musical literature works, and better reveal the artistic charm of the pre-Qin works.Firstly, this article defines the musical literature and introduces the current research andthe significance to musical literature of pre-Qin. The second chapter of the thesis notices fromthe ancient poetry. This section focuses on the integration of poetry and music and its origin,development and structural function, and then combs the ancient ballads, six generations ofgreat music and dance, and musical structure in the Poetry of the South.nine songs. The thirdchapter of the thesis starts with The Book of Poetry as research subjects. It analyses specificissues on the basis of a large number of arguments for the The Book of Poetry as the backgroundof musical literature, the usage ‘poem’ phenomenon in general life, music officer system in theZhou dynasty, and musical structure of The Book of Poetry, etc. The fourth part of the thesisdiscusses many excellent works of musical literature in the process of the transformation ofvulgar and popular, such as Shang Bo bamboo slips the folk songs tracks, the way to be officers,Xunzi·phase, Chu-Feng and Poetry of the South. The fifth part of the thesis beginning with theperspective of the rites and music system, puts forward the concept of musical literaturesystem.Musical literature system mainly refers to the specific creation and rules in musicalliterature under the background of rites and music. Musical literature is the literature whichunder this system, having profound institutional literature characteristics. According todiscussion to the pre-Qin musical literature system, we can restore the hierarchy of musical literature to a certain extent, which helps us better understand the literary style under the ritesand music system of pre-Qin. The sixth part of the thesis mainly concerns about Shang Bobamboo slips Confucian poetics and Xun Zi·theory of music. It tries to mining the profoundmeaning from the view of musical literature theory, and expects to fulfill in the existing systemof literary theory. From the perspective of musical literature theory, Confucius’ poetics, whichcontains Confucius’s attitudes to the relationship between poetry and music and reveals to theirpolitical civilization function, has a huge significance, and offers new materials to the existingliterature of pre-Qin music theory. The article is on the perspective of musical literature toreview Xun Zi the theory of music, and reflects Xun Zi’s view of ritual and music and elaboratethe beauty of poems and music in Xun Zi’s “moderation and harmony”.In a word, the article has a systemic and detailed summarizes to the excellent andrepresentative musical literature works of pre-Qin,which is based on the view of the pre-Qinmusical literature.In this way, we are able to understand the inherent charm and grasp thebeauty of the pre-Qin literature better.
